Split Portraits Explore Human Genetics and How Closely Family Members Resemble One Another

Do people ever tell you that you look just like one of your parents? Or maybe you look almost identical to your sibling. Through his ongoing Genetic Portraits series (which began in 2008), Quebec-based designer and photographer Ulric Collette explores how members of the same family resemble each other, how they’re different, and the role genetics plays in a person’s physical appearance. Collette’s images aren’t your ordinary family portraits.

Nikon Created a Camera Mount for Dogs That Takes Photos Every Time Their Heart Rate Rises

Photographers are naturally drawn to the people, landscapes, and moments that move them emotionally. But have you ever wondered what a dog would photograph? In 2015, Nikon set out to find out by creating a camera harness with a built-in heart-rate monitor. Whenever a dog’s heart started fluttering with excitement, the camera automatically took a picture, offering a glimpse into the world through canine eyes.

Camera Brand DJI Commands 73% Market Share in Japan (Despite an Uncertain U.S. Fate)

The camera brand DJI is known for its drones and handheld cameras that let you capture the action as it’s happening. Synonymous with incredible shots captured by its users, DJI’s technology and reputation have translated into serious market share. According to a 2026 report from Japanese retail analyst BCN+R, DJI holds a 72.5% market share in Japan’s video camera market—up from 64.7% in 2025.
